The two major privacy coins Zcash and Monero are joined by several, less-well-known currencies, and they are creating avenues by which people can achieve privacy in their online purchases and transactions.<\/p>\n<h2>Zcash<\/h2>\n<p><a href=\"http:\/\/crypto slate.com\/coins\/zcash\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"logo alignleft wp-image-2213 size-thumbnail\" src=\"http:\/\/cryptoslate.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/09\/zcash-logo-150x150.jpg\" alt=\"Zcash\" width=\"150\" height=\"150\" srcset=\"https:\/\/cryptoslate.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/09\/zcash-logo-150x150.jpg 150w, https:\/\/cryptoslate.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/09\/zcash-logo.jpg 300w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 150px) 100vw, 150px\" \/><\/a><a href=\"https:\/\/cryptoslate.com\/coins\/zcash\/\">Zcash<\/a> is one of the newest arrivals in the privacy-focused cryptocurrency market. First launched in 2016, Zcash builds on the promise of the blockchain and cryptocurrencies to create a functional digital currency that enhances privacy and security through end-to-end encryption that is accessible by using zero knowledge proofs.<\/p>\n<p>Known as zk-SNARK and established by the Zcash development team, this protocol allows \u201cthe network to maintain a secure ledger of balances without disclosing the parties or amounts involved.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Zcash empowers users to operate privately or to complete public payments smooth and transparent way.<\/p>\n<figure id=\"attachment_4416\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-4416\" style=\"width: 300px\" class=\"wp-caption alignright\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-medium wp-image-4416\" src=\"http:\/\/cryptoslate.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/10\/zcash-privacy-300x96.jpg\" alt=\"\" width=\"300\" height=\"96\" srcset=\"https:\/\/cryptoslate.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/10\/zcash-privacy-300x96.jpg 300w, https:\/\/cryptoslate.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/10\/zcash-privacy.jpg 600w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 300px) 100vw, 300px\" \/><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-4416\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">Zcash payments are published on a public blockchain, but users are able to use an optional privacy feature to conceal the sender, recipient, and amount being transacted. Like Bitcoin, Zcash has a fixed total supply of 21 million units.<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<p>While Zcash is certainly pushing innovation, there are concerns about its security and cryptography standards. In a 2016 blog post, a Bitcoin developer expressed concerns about the viability of zk-SNARK.<\/p>\n<p>Therefore, as Zcash attempts to scale, it will need to continually address security concerns even as it proliferates its platform.<\/p>\n<p>Zcash is often confused with the less popular but still emerging Zcoin. Both currencies rely on zero knowledge proofs, but according to ZCoin, \u201cThere is otherwise no relation between the two projects.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>However, the fact that there are multiple cryptocurrencies striving to develop the same security standards should mean that the standard will mature more quickly and will help further proliferate Zcash and others that embrace the zero knowledge proof approach to cryptography.<\/p>\n<h2>Monero<\/h2>\n<p><a href=\"http:\/\/crypto slate.com\/coins\/monero\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"logo alignleft wp-image-366 size-thumbnail\" src=\"http:\/\/cryptoslate.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/09\/logo-monero-150x150.jpg\" alt=\"Monero\" width=\"150\" height=\"150\" srcset=\"https:\/\/cryptoslate.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/09\/logo-monero-150x150.jpg 150w, https:\/\/cryptoslate.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/09\/logo-monero.jpg 300w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 150px) 100vw, 150px\" \/><\/a><\/p>\n<p>Functioning in a similar capacity as Bitcoin, <a href=\"https:\/\/cryptoslate.com\/coins\/monero\/\">Monero<\/a> differentiates itself primarily through this privacy component. In a profile on the currency, Wired writes that Monero is designed \u201cto be fully anonymous and virtually untraceable.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Monero primarily pursues user privacy in two ways: by concealing account balances and by mixing transactions.<\/p>\n<p>When working with the blockchain, everyone has a public address, and with c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in and Ethereum, transactions are associated with that public address. Monero explains that, when sending funds using Bitcoin, \u201cYou announce to the entire Bitcoin network that the funds that you own now belong to the recipient\u2019s public address.Everyone can see.&#8221;<\/p>\n<p>In contrast, while Monero users have a public blockchain address, their funds are not associated with that address. To accomplish this, Monero uses a temporary public address to which transactions are sent and received by a temporary, randomly created address.<\/p>\n<figure id=\"attachment_4415\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-4415\" style=\"width: 300px\" class=\"wp-caption alignright\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-medium wp-image-4415\" src=\"http:\/\/cryptoslate.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/10\/monero-privacy-300x96.jpg\" alt=\"\" width=\"300\" height=\"96\" srcset=\"https:\/\/cryptoslate.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/10\/monero-privacy-300x96.jpg 300w, https:\/\/cryptoslate.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/10\/monero-privacy.jpg 600w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 300px) 100vw, 300px\" \/><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-4415\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">Monero (XMR) is an open-source cryptocurrency created in April 2014 that focuses on privacy, decentralization and scalability that runs on Windows, Mac, Linux, Android, and FreeBSD.<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<p>As a result, there is no public record of transactions, so users can maintain privacy regarding their financial holdings. Of course, if they want to, account holders can share their balance information with anyone by creating a \u201csecret view key,\u201d which allows key recipients to view the account holder\u2019s balance and transactions.<\/p>\n<p>In addition to concealing users account balances, Monero masks their transactions using a technique known as \u201cring signatures.\u201d CoinDesk helpfully explains this concept as a process that combines \u201ca user\u2019s account keys with public keys obtained from Monero\u2019s blockchain to create a \u2018ring\u2019 of possible signers.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>This means that transactions remain anonymous because they are indistinguishable from one another. In this way, Monero embraces privacy protection at the account and transactional level.<\/p>\n<p>Monero can be purchased on cryptocurrency exchanges including Poloniex, Bitfinex, and Kraken.
